Bismarck (CSi) — Agriculture and food have been deemed essential industries by the Dept of Homeland Security, and Ag Commissioner Doug Goehring reminds people that beekeepers and their employees are included in that definition.

Bismarck Gov. Doug Burgum Monday signed two executive orders designed to slow the spread of COVID-19 in North Dakota and protect the most vulnerable from the coronavirus disease by limiting visitation to long-term care facilities.
